Mary Robinson

President, Mary Robinson Foundation - Climate Justice
Mary Robinson served as President of Ireland from 1990-1997 and UN High Commissioner for Human Rights from 1997-2002. She is a member of the Elders and the recipient of numerous honours and awards, including the Presidential Medal of Freedom from the President of the United States Barack Obama. She serves as Honorary President of Oxfam International and Chair or the Global Leaders Council on Reproductive Health.
